The safest jobs I ever ran weren't the ones with the thickest binder in the trailer. They were the ones where safety lived on the same wall as the schedule. When the plan for next week and the hazards for next week are the same conversation, people actually see the exposure coming. When they're separate — a safety guy off doing his thing, a superintendent off doing his — you end up reacting to incidents instead of planning around them.
That's really the whole argument for tying safety into your look-ahead process rather than treating it as a parallel program. Plan the hazard when you plan the work
The single highest-leverage habit is running your hazard analysis on the same cadence as your weekly work plan. Not once at mobilization. Every week, against the actual activities you just committed to.
When you pull your three-week look-ahead and start populating next week's work, walk each activity and ask a short set of questions: What's the energy source here — gravity, electrical, stored pressure, traffic? Who's overhead of whom? What's the fall exposure, and does the protection exist yet or does it need to be built first? Where do two trades share the same footprint on the same day?
That last one is where people get hurt. The masons are grinding, the electricians are pulling wire below them, and nobody sequenced it so they'd be apart. A look-ahead built around location — which is how location-based schedules like the ones in LookAheadWall are set up — makes those overlaps visible because you can literally see two trade flows crossing the same zone in the same window. On a bar chart by activity, that collision is invisible. On a plan organized by area, it jumps out.
Rule of thumb: any activity that shows up new on the two-week horizon gets a fresh look at its task hazard analysis. Recycling last month's JHA for a task whose conditions changed is how a good-looking binder gets someone killed.
Give hazardous work real lead time
Half of jobsite safety failures are really schedule failures wearing a safety costume. The work got compressed, the permit wasn't ready, the protection wasn't installed, so somebody improvised. The fix isn't a poster. It's lead time, and lead time is what a rolling look-ahead is for.
Some concrete buffers worth building into your planning:
- Permitted work needs to appear on the four-week horizon, not the one-week. Hot work, confined space entry, and energized electrical work all carry approvals, standby requirements, and sometimes third-party sign-off. If the confined-space entry hits your weekly plan as a surprise, you either delay the crew or you cut a corner. Neither is good. Flag it three to four weeks out so the permit, the attendant, the air monitoring, and the rescue plan are lined up before boots go in the hole.
- Fall protection gets scheduled as its own activity, ahead of the work it protects. Guardrail, netting, or a horizontal lifeline is a predecessor, not an afterthought. If leading-edge work is on Wednesday, the perimeter protection is a Monday–Tuesday task with its own duration. Tie it in your trade-flow sequence so the schedule won't let the exposed work start before its protection is complete.
- Crane picks and steel erection want a coordinated exclusion window. The overhead work drives everyone else off the ground below it. Sequence the trades out of that zone rather than hoping they'll stay clear.
- Utility tie-ins and demo want a locate and a lockout plan a week ahead. "We'll figure out the isolation the morning of" is the sentence right before an arc flash.
The point of a look-ahead isn't just to know what's coming. It's to know it far enough out that the safe version of the task is the achievable version. Compression kills the safe method first.
Tie qualifications to the assignment, not to a filing cabinet
Certifications and training only protect anyone if they're checked at the moment of assignment. A stack of cards in the office does nothing if the guy you put in the aerial lift Tuesday morning let his certification lapse in March.
The practical move is to make qualification part of how crews get scheduled. When you assign a worker or a crew to a task that carries a requirement — aerial lift, forklift, rigging and signaling, competent-person duties, respirator fit — the qualification for that task should be something you can see against that name before the work starts, not something you reconstruct after an inspector asks.
This matters even more with subs. On a job of any size, most of your exposure walks in through the gate wearing another company's logo. Bake safety history into prequalification — EMR, OSHA 300 log summaries, citation history — and don't authorize a trade partner to start until their site-specific orientation, competent-person designations, and required submittals are actually in hand. "They said they'd send it" is not documentation. Make the paperwork a predecessor to their first day the same way you'd make a submittal approval a predecessor to a material order.
Capture the field record where the work happens
Toolbox talks, pre-task plans, near-miss reports, and inspection checklists are worth having for two reasons: they change behavior in the moment, and they're your defense when a claim shows up two years later. Both reasons collapse if capturing the record is a pain.
The gold standard is that a foreman can document from the work face, on a phone, tied to the actual activity and location — not back at the trailer at 4:30 filling in what he half-remembers. A near-miss reported with a photo, geotagged to the zone, attached to the activity that was underway, is worth ten times a line item in a spreadsheet. It tells you where your risk actually is, and it does it while the detail is still fresh.
A few things that separate a real field-documentation habit from theater:
- Toolbox talk topics should follow next week's work. If Monday's plan is silica-generating cutting, the talk is on respirable silica and water controls — not a generic recycled topic. Let the schedule drive the subject.
- Near-miss reporting has to be blameless and fast, or it dies. The first time you discipline a guy for reporting a near-miss, you've bought yourself a jobsite where nobody reports anything until it's an ambulance ride. Make it two taps and a photo, and thank people for it out loud.
- Inspection checklists belong on a cadence, tied to location. Daily housekeeping and fall-protection walks, weekly ladder and electrical, plus event-driven checks after weather. Tie the results to the area so a recurring problem in one zone shows up as a pattern instead of a scatter of one-offs.
Read the leading indicators, not just the lagging ones
Recordable rates and lost-time counts tell you what already hurt someone. Useful for the insurance renewal, useless for preventing next week's incident. The numbers that actually steer a job are the leading ones, and a system that's already capturing field activity can surface them cheaply.
Watch these:
- Near-miss and hazard-observation volume. Counterintuitively, you want this number up. A crew that reports lots of near-misses is a crew that's paying attention. A sudden drop usually means people stopped reporting, not that the site got safe.
- Pre-task plan completion against scheduled activities. If 40% of this week's tasks have no PTP, that's a gap you can close before Monday, not after an incident.
- Open corrective actions and their age. A hazard identified and left open for three weeks is worse than one never spotted, because now it's documented negligence.
- Trade-density in shared zones. How often are two or more trades stacked in the same area on the same day? That congestion number correlates with incidents better than almost anything, and your location-based look-ahead can show it before the week starts.
None of this requires a separate analytics platform. It falls out of the field records you're already collecting, if you're collecting them against the schedule instead of into a void.
The habit that actually moves the needle
Strip away the software talk and the discipline is simple: safety planning happens at the same table, on the same rhythm, and against the same activities as your short-interval schedule. Every week you sit down to build the weekly work plan, you also walk the hazards, confirm the qualifications, check that the permits and protection have their lead time, and set the toolbox topics off the actual work. The right tool — a look-ahead that's organized by location and connects trade sequences, so overlaps and exposures are visible — makes that walk faster and harder to skip. But the tool is the enabler, not the point.
The point is that on a well-run job, nobody experiences "safety" as a separate thing that slows the work down. They experience a plan where the safe way to do the task and the scheduled way to do the task are the same way. That's the whole game. Get the hazard onto the wall next to the work, give it lead time, and the incidents you never have won't show up in any report — which is exactly the result you're after.
